Ingredients
- 500 grams pork – diced to small pieces
- 100 grams red onion – sliced into thin strips
- small bunch mint
- 150 grams rice, uncooked, brown in fry pan, then pound into flour
- 6 tablespoon lemon juice
- 6 tablespoons fish sauce
- 2 teaspoons roti (like bullion)
- 1 teaspoon msg
- 1 tablespoon sugar
- 2 tablespoon chili powder (or more for spicy)
- small bunch parsley
- 2 or 3 green onions
How to Make
Mix half lemon juice and half fish sauce, then add to pork. Knead pork and juice together, then squeeze juice from pork mix into wok and heat until it bubble. Then add in pork and cook until done.
Turn off heat, then mix in all other ingredients, except parsley and green onion.
Put parsley and green onion on top when serving. Enough for 3 or 4 people.

Ingredients
- pork 1/2 kilo thin sliced
- rotdee – 3 tablespoons
- honey – 3 tablespoons
- oyster sauce – 6 tablespoons
- Maggi cooking sauce – 3 tablespoons
- sweet soy sauce – 1 tablespoon
- soy sauce – 1 tablespoon
- sugar – 3 tablespoons
- black pepper – 3 tablespoons
How to Cook
Add each ingredient to pork one at a time and mix before adding next one. Let sit and marinate for at least 15 minutes or more.
Add a little oil to wok, heat and stir fry until done. Do not cook too long or will get chewy.

Ingredients
- Red curry paste 1 spoon
- Cooking oil 1 spoon
- Pork slice 400 grams
- Fish Sauce 1 and half spoon
- Sugar half spoon
- Lemon leaf 3-4 leaves slice (same as put in tom yum kung )
- Fresh pepper little bit
- Red pepper 2 and slice
- Coconut milk 1 small container
How to cook
Put oil in first wait till it get hot. And then put red curry in, wait for while. Then put pork in and fry it for about 5 minutes till it cook. Then put half coconut milk in then fry them about 5 minutes till you see fat of coconut milk. Then put other half coconut milk in, fry then together and then put the other flavors in. Wait for 2 minutes and then turn it off.

Ingredients
- Garlic 1 and half tablespoon
- Chili 1/2 or 1 tablespoon
- Basil leaf
- oil ( use low oil ) 3 – 5 tablespoon
- Chicken (pork or seafood)
- Fish sauce 1 – 2 tablespoon
- MSG ( if you like ) 2 pinches
- Oyster sauce 1 tablespoon ( if you like )
- Sweet black sauce 1 tablespoon
- Sugar 1/2 – 1 tablespoon
How to cook
1. First pook pook (pound in mortar) or dice & crush chili and garlic together.
2. Turn electric pan on til it gets hot, then put some oil in and wait for while until oil getting hot then put chili and garlic in.
3. After that put chicken in and cook for few minutes, until it is done. Then put some sweet black sauce, oyster sauce( if you like ), MSG ( if you like ), fish sauce , little bit of sugar (because sugar makes good flavor for everything )
4. And then put basil in, then turn the pan off and let sit for a minute.
5. Serve on top of rice as Thai style
